What Is Proportional Controller

What is proportional controller

What is proportional controller

Proportional control is a control system technology based on a response in proportion to the difference between what is set as a desired process variable (or set point) and the current value of the variable.

What is proportional controller and what are its advantages?

The proportional controller helps in reducing the steady-state error, thus makes the system more stable. The slow response of the overdamped system can be made faster with the help of these controllers.

What is proportional controller advantages and disadvantages?

The main advantage of P+I is that it can eliminate the offset in proportional control. The disadvantages of P+I are that it gives rise to a higher maximum deviation, a longer response time and a longer period of oscillation than with proportional action alone.

What are disadvantages of proportional controller?

A drawback of proportional control is that it cannot eliminate the residual SP − PV error in processes with compensation e.g. temperature control, as it requires an error to generate a proportional output.

Why is PID controller used?

A PID controller is an instrument used in industrial control applications to regulate temperature, flow, pressure, speed and other process variables. PID (proportional integral derivative) controllers use a control loop feedback mechanism to control process variables and are the most accurate and stable controller.

How does PID work in Plc?

The PID controller receives the process variable (PV) and controls the manipulation variable (MV) in order to adjust the PV to match the set value (SV). In the PLC, a PID function block and analog input/output modules are used for PID control (one PID loop).

What is derivative controller?

Derivative control monitors the rate of change of the process variable and makes changes to the controller output to accommodate unusual changes.

How do you make a proportional controller?

General Tips for Designing a PID Controller

  1. Obtain an open-loop response and determine what needs to be improved.
  2. Add a proportional control to improve the rise time.
  3. Add a derivative control to reduce the overshoot.
  4. Add an integral control to reduce the steady-state error.
  5. Adjust each of the gains , , and.

How is PID value calculated?

PID basics The PID formula weights the proportional term by a factor of P, the integral term by a factor of P/TI, and the derivative term by a factor of P.TD where P is the controller gain, TI is the integral time, and TD is the derivative time.

Where is PD controller used?

A proportional-derivative (PD) controller can be used to make a simple system track some reference point. The suspension in a car is an analogue example: the spring and damper work together to hold the car at some desired height.
